Map network drive

For some lectures you need access to specific network shares, probably known as W: , X: , and Y: . If you don't find it you can map yourself:

 Start button: left click
 Computer: right click: Map Network drive
 
 Seclect Drive you like:
 Folder: \\134,102.241.71\share  (or 72, or 73)
 
 Tick "Reconnect at logon" if you are sure you use the correct drive
 Do not tick "Connect using different credentials"
